Dionisios Fragias is a New York -based artist born on the Greek island of Kefalonia and raised in New York City. He is the protege of the artist Jeff Koons whose years-long mentorship, working very closely together, has instilled in the artist a sensitive approach to his art practice. Through his own works, Fragias examines human nature’s tendencies towards creation and destruction. His free-standing sculptures, “hybrid” paintings/wall-sculptures and other diverse-media works connect our past to the present. In his latest series, Emergency Inspiration, the artist expands on certain questions that are at the core of art-making: How do artists respond in times of uncertainty? How can we gain a better personal understanding of a crises old and new, real or fabricated throughout daily practices? Several of the new works come together in the current exhibition titled, The Landscape I Can’t Unsee, the artworks mine a mixture of imagery that is taken from historical archives and contemporary digital databases. Memes and familiar iconographies are re-drawn and stylized in a collective manner that invite’s one to contemplate certain prescient issues that we constantly face.
Fragias has participated in numerous solo and group exhibitions throughout the United States, Greece, Switzerland, Belgium, etc. His artworks have been collected by major institutions including the Hearst collection in New York. His largest sculpture, Icarus Empires is permanently exhibited in the main lobby of the Hearst Tower.

About the Series:
Gilliam began the series Life Lines in 2017 after recently coming into possession of MRI scans of her brain. The scans, which she spent hours pouring over, both fascinated and horrified her. Gilliam always knew the seriousness of the brain injury suffered as a baby; however, it was the first time she confronted the visual evidence of the injury. Around the same time, she experienced a continuous period of profound familial loss. Both these episodes left her thinking about the body in a new light. This led her to study the biology and physiology of our bodies and the seemingly cruel, capricious way the body can behave, vacillating between strength and fragility. Gilliam began to make drawings from the MRIs recording the brain to understand how its structure and pathways form to activate the circumstances of the individual being we become. As the series has developed, the imagery has dissolved into abstraction, capturing something more existential. The repetitive lines revealed rhythms, and the patterns formed conversations. Ultimately, Life Lines has evolved into a visual story about connections, threading together a human body with its physical, metaphysical, and interpersonal environment.
About the Artist:
Claire Gilliam is an English photographer, printmaker, painter now based from her home and studio in Warwick, NY.
In 1997, she graduated from Sheffield Hallam University in the UK with a BA(Hons) in Fine Art and completed the Professional Certificate in Photography at Rockport College, Maine in 2000. She has studied with photographers such as Arno Minkkinen and John Goodman and master gelatin silver printer, Chuck Kelton and master printmaker, Vijay Kumar. She is an assistant for author and fine art photographer Barbara Mensch.
